Welcome to the Quellhorn platform team. Your first rotation task is maintaining Alertfold, our on-call alert deduplicator. Alertfold groups duplicate pages by fingerprint and suppresses repeats within a ten-minute window, so PagerPath only fires once per incident. Builds are produced by the Tinbridge CI pool and must be signed before deploy. Config lives in the alertfold-ops repo. The deploy key you will use is below.

rollout seal: bky6_osViJn

Welcome aboard. The Corvette config service supports hot-reloading: any change to `.env.runtime` is picked up within five seconds by the watcher thread, without a process restart. As a contractor, please edit only the runtime file, never the baked defaults in `config/base.toml`. Reload events are logged with a checksum so we can audit exactly what changed and when. Before your first reload test, the file must end with the line that sets the reload signing secret, shown below.

env line for fafof-fahag: LEDGER_TOKEN5=f8790

## Onboarding — Markdown Pipeline (Inkmere)

Inkmere docs render through a three-stage pipeline: parse, sanitize, emit. Releases rebuild all templates; never hot-patch emitted HTML. Broken renders usually mean a sanitizer rule change — check the rules diff first. The render cluster only accepts builds from the release channel, and every build artifact must be signed before upload. Sign artifacts with the deploy key below.

release key, hafop-tajef: bky13_s2vaFVNJTHfBL

- [ ] **Verify tile-cache key custody (Cartwheel Maps team).** Before sealing the ceremony envelope, confirm the Ridgeline tile-rendering cache layer has been flushed and its encryption key rotated. Two witnesses must initial the ledger. New members: do not skip the flush, or stale tiles persist. Confirm rotation in the console using the passphrase below.

unlock words, fajof-kahip: ulaath-zorael-drumir